Перейти к основному содержанию

Documentation Index

Fetch the complete documentation index at: https://docs.xhuoapi.ai/llms.txt

Use this file to discover all available pages before exploring further.

MCP (Model Context Protocol) — это протокол контекста модели, разработанный Anthropic, который позволяет AI-моделям (таким как Claude, GPT и др.) вызывать внешние инструменты через стандартизированный интерфейс. С помощью Veo MCP Server от XHuoAPI вы можете напрямую использовать Google Veo для генерации AI-видео в клиентах Claude Desktop, VS Code, Cursor и других.

Обзор функций

Veo MCP Server предоставляет следующие основные возможности:
  • Генерация видео из текста — создание высококачественного видео по текстовому запросу
  • Генерация видео из изображения — создание видео на основе изображения
  • Поддержка нескольких моделей — поддержка моделей veo3, veo2, veo31-fast-ingredients и других
  • Различные разрешения — поддержка форматов вывода 4K, 1080p, GIF и др.
  • Различные соотношения сторон — поддержка пропорций 16:9, 9:16 и др.
  • Апгрейд до 1080p — повышение качества уже сгенерированного видео до 1080p
  • Запрос состояния задач — мониторинг прогресса генерации и получение результатов

Предварительные требования

Перед использованием необходимо получить API Token XHuoAPI:
  1. Зарегистрируйтесь или войдите на XHuoAPI Platform
  2. Перейдите на страницу Veo Videos API
  3. Нажмите «Acquire» для получения API Token (при первом запросе предоставляется бесплатный лимит)

Установка и настройка

Способ 1: установка через pip (рекомендуется)

pip install mcp-veo

Способ 2: установка из исходников

git clone https://github.com/XHuoAPI/VeoMCP.git
cd VeoMCP
pip install -e .
После установки можно запускать сервис командой mcp-veo.

Использование в Claude Desktop

Отредактируйте конфигурационный файл Claude Desktop:
  • macOS: ~/Library/Application Support/Claude/claude_desktop_config.json
  • Windows: %APPDATA%\Claude\claude_desktop_config.json
Добавьте следующую конфигурацию:
{
  "mcpServers": {
    "veo": {
      "command": "mcp-veo",
      "env": {
        "XHuoAPI_API_TOKEN": "ваш API Token"
      }
    }
  }
}
Если используете uvx (не требует предварительной установки пакетов):
{
  "mcpServers": {
    "veo": {
      "command": "uvx",
      "args": ["mcp-veo"],
      "env": {
        "XHuoAPI_API_TOKEN": "ваш API Token"
      }
    }
  }
}
Сохраните изменения и перезапустите Claude Desktop — теперь вы сможете использовать инструменты Veo в диалогах.

Использование в VS Code / Cursor

Создайте файл .vscode/mcp.json в корне проекта:
{
  "servers": {
    "veo": {
      "command": "mcp-veo",
      "env": {
        "XHuoAPI_API_TOKEN": "ваш API Token"
      }
    }
  }
}
Или с использованием uvx:
{
  "servers": {
    "veo": {
      "command": "uvx",
      "args": ["mcp-veo"],
      "env": {
        "XHuoAPI_API_TOKEN": "ваш API Token"
      }
    }
  }
}

Список доступных инструментов

Название инструментаОписание
veo_text_to_videoГенерация видео по текстовому запросу
veo_image_to_videoГенерация видео на основе изображения
veo_get_1080pАпгрейд видео до 1080p
veo_get_taskЗапрос статуса одной задачи
veo_get_tasks_batchМассовый запрос статусов задач

Примеры использования

После настройки вы можете напрямую вызывать эти функции в AI-клиентах с помощью естественного языка, например:
  • «Помоги мне сгенерировать видео с таймлапсом звездного неба с помощью Veo»
  • «Сделай 4K видео на основе этой фотографии пейзажа»
  • «Создай короткое вертикальное видео с соотношением 9:16»
  • «Повыши качество этого видео до 1080p»

Дополнительная информация